Hardware: Why iPhone 8?

We started our farm with exactly 10 iPhones. Specifically, we purchased second-hand iPhone 8s—many with cracked screens and cosmetic damage to keep costs low.

iPhones vs. Androids

While Androids are much more accessible for scripting and automation, iPhones are trusted more by TikTok and Instagram due to Apple's strict security architecture and closed ecosystem. Using iPhones significantly reduced the chance of our accounts getting flagged.

  • Cheap: Used iPhone 8s can be found for very low prices.
  • Security: iOS architecture provides natural trust signals to social platforms.
  • Reliability: Consistent performance for content playback and uploading.

Account Warm-up Process

You cannot create a new account and immediately blast 5 videos. We spent significant time warming up each device just like a real user would—scrolling, liking, and commenting.

The Warm-Up Protocol

Duration: 4 days
Daily Action: 15-20 minutes of scrolling per day.
Engagement: Natural liking and commenting on relevant content.
This process also applies to ongoing maintenance to keep accounts healthy.

Content Strategy & AI Editing

We needed to produce about 60+ reels and TikToks a day. We started with a bunch of raw footage of our product, including UGC-like clips and photos. The key was making it look like real UGC (user-generated content).

The AI Agent Pipeline

To keep up with volume without hiring a full editing team, we built an AI agent to handle the heavy lifting:

  1. The agent takes 2 videos and combines them into a single video in various dynamic formats.
  2. Formats included "brainrot" style (like Subway Surfers gameplay underneath) and rapid 3-second hook videos.
  3. We edited the clips to add aesthetic style, voiceovers, and subtitles.

Some videos were simple unboxings, while others were highly trend-focused. The goal was to keep it raw—nothing too polished. We ran gazillions of tests to see what stuck.

Posting Schedule & Algorithm

Volume is the name of the game. We posted 3 times a day per account across 10 devices, resulting in 60 unique pieces of content going out every single day.

Automation & Scheduling

TikTok has an internal content scheduling tool, so we utilized that to schedule our content up to 10 days out. Remember: even when scheduled, you must manually scroll 15-20 minutes a day to keep the account "warm" and trusted.

The TikTok Algorithm

TikTok probably has the BEST recommendation algorithm out there, so why not (ab)use it? From our testing, it takes the algorithm about 90 minutes of total scrolling by a new user account to tailor the feed and categorize the profile.
